System and method for optimizing a production process using electromagnetic-based local positioning capabilities
First Claim
1. A system for optimizing a process within a work cell, wherein the process has a calibrated sequence, the system comprising:
- a handheld tool configured to execute steps of the calibrated sequence with respect to a work piece;
an electromagnetic marker connected to the handheld tool, wherein the electromagnetic marker is configured to emit a calibrated magnetic field within the work cell;
a stationary electromagnetic receptor positioned in the work cell external to the handheld tool and adapted to measure the emitted calibrated magnetic field, and to generate a raw positional signal in response thereto;
a processing core in communication with the stationary electromagnetic receptor, the processing core being adapted for processing the raw positional signal to thereby calculate each of a position value and an attitude value in the form of yaw, pitch, and roll for the handheld tool;
a control unit that selectively updates a performance setting of the handheld tool;
a graphical user interface (GUI); and
a host machine in communication with the GUI, the control unit, and the processing core, wherein the host machine is operable for;
displaying, via the GUI, an expected position from the calibrated sequence;
continuously monitoring a present position of the handheld tool within the work cell using the position value and the attitude value;
comparing the present position of the handheld tool to the displayed expected position in the calibrated sequence;
comparing a current performance setting of the handheld tool to an expected performance setting corresponding to the displayed expected position; and
executing a control action, including temporarily disabling the handheld tool, when the present position of the handheld tool is not equal to the displayed expected position in the calibrated sequence, and updating the performance setting of the handheld tool via the control unit when the current performance setting is not equal to the expected performance setting.
1 Assignment
0 Petitions
Accused Products
Abstract
A system includes a handheld tool for executing steps of a sequence within a work cell. An electromagnetic marker connected to the tool emits a magnetic field within the cell. A receptor detects the magnetic field and generates a raw position signal in response thereto. A control unit updates an assembly setting of the tool. The host executes a control action when a position determined using the raw data is not equal to an expected position in the sequence. A method calculates the present position of a torque wrench using magnetic fields generated by the marker and measured by a receptor array, and calculates a present position of the tool or a fastener. The present position of the fastener may be compared to an expected position in the calibrated sequence, and the torque wrench may be disabled when the fastener position is not equal to the expected position.
-
Citations
14 Claims
-
1. A system for optimizing a process within a work cell, wherein the process has a calibrated sequence, the system comprising:
-
a handheld tool configured to execute steps of the calibrated sequence with respect to a work piece; an electromagnetic marker connected to the handheld tool, wherein the electromagnetic marker is configured to emit a calibrated magnetic field within the work cell; a stationary electromagnetic receptor positioned in the work cell external to the handheld tool and adapted to measure the emitted calibrated magnetic field, and to generate a raw positional signal in response thereto; a processing core in communication with the stationary electromagnetic receptor, the processing core being adapted for processing the raw positional signal to thereby calculate each of a position value and an attitude value in the form of yaw, pitch, and roll for the handheld tool; a control unit that selectively updates a performance setting of the handheld tool; a graphical user interface (GUI); and a host machine in communication with the GUI, the control unit, and the processing core, wherein the host machine is operable for; displaying, via the GUI, an expected position from the calibrated sequence; continuously monitoring a present position of the handheld tool within the work cell using the position value and the attitude value; comparing the present position of the handheld tool to the displayed expected position in the calibrated sequence; comparing a current performance setting of the handheld tool to an expected performance setting corresponding to the displayed expected position; and executing a control action, including temporarily disabling the handheld tool, when the present position of the handheld tool is not equal to the displayed expected position in the calibrated sequence, and updating the performance setting of the handheld tool via the control unit when the current performance setting is not equal to the expected performance setting.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A system for optimizing a fastener installation process within a work cell, the system comprising:
-
a handheld torque wrench adapted to install a threaded fastener into a work piece, the handheld torque wrench having a rotatable shaft that rotates about an axis of rotation; an electromagnetic marker connected to the handheld torque wrench such that the axis of rotation passes through the electromagnetic marker, wherein the electromagnetic marker is adapted to emit calibrated magnetic fields in close proximity to the handheld torque wrench within the work cell; a stationary array of electromagnetic receptors positioned in the work cell external to the handheld torque wrench and adapted to measure the emitted magnetic fields, and to generate a raw positional signal in response thereto; a processing core in communication with the array of receptors, wherein the processing core is adapted for processing the positional signal to thereby calculate a position value and an attitude value in the form of yaw, pitch, and roll for the electromagnetic marker; a fastener control unit (FCU) that selectively updates a performance setting of the handheld torque wrench; a graphical user interface (GUI); and a host machine in communication with the processing core, the FCU, the GUI, and the electromagnetic marker, wherein the host machine is operable for; displaying, via the GUI, an expected position from a calibrated sequence; continuously monitoring a present position of the handheld torque wrench using the position value and the attitude value; calculating a present position of the threaded fastener using the present position of the handheld torque wrench; comparing the present position of the threaded fastener to the displayed expected fastener position in a calibrated fastener sequence; and executing at least one control action, including temporarily disabling the handheld torque wrench, when the present position of the threaded fastener is not equal to the expected fastener position, and updating the performance setting of the handheld torque wrench via the FCU when a current performance setting of the handheld torque wrench is not equal to an expected performance setting of the handheld torque wrench. - View Dependent Claims (7, 8, 9, 10)
-
-
11. A method for optimizing a fastener installation process within a work cell, the method comprising:
-
emitting a calibrated magnetic field via an electromagnetic marker positioned within the work cell; sensing the calibrated magnetic field via an electromagnetic receptor array, wherein one of the electromagnetic marker and the electromagnetic receptor array is connected to a handheld torque wrench; generating a raw positional signal using the receptor array; processing the raw positional signal using a processing core to thereby convert the raw position signal into a position value and an attitude value of the electromagnetic marker in the form of yaw, pitch, and roll; and continuously monitoring a present position of the handheld torque wrench within the work cell, via a host machine, based on the position value and the attitude value; comparing the present position of the handheld torque wrench to an expected position in a calibrated sequence; displaying, via a graphical user interface (GUI), an expected position from a calibrated sequence; comparing a current performance setting of the handheld torque wrench to an expected performance setting from the calibrated sequence; and executing a control action, including temporarily disabling the handheld torque wrench, when the present position of the handheld torque wrench is not equal to the expected position in the calibrated sequence, and updating the performance setting of the handheld torque wrench via a fastener control unit when the current performance setting is not equal to the expected performance setting. - View Dependent Claims (12, 13, 14)
-
Specification